NRB sets foreign currency exchange rates for today



KATHMANDU: Nepal Rastra Bank (NRB) has set the foreign exchange rates for today (Sunday). The buying rate for one US dollar stands at Rs 150.50, while the selling rate is Rs 151.10.

The euro is being traded at Rs 176.36 (buying) and Rs 177.07 (selling), the UK pound sterling at Rs 203.23 and Rs 204.04, and the Swiss franc at Rs 191.63 and Rs 192.40, respectively.

Among other major currencies, the Australian dollar is priced at Rs 107.63 (buying) and Rs 108.06 (selling), the Canadian dollar at Rs 109.95 and Rs 110.39, and the Singapore dollar at Rs 117.95 and Rs 118.42.

In Asian currencies, 10 Japanese yen are valued at Rs 9.44 (buying) and Rs 9.48 (selling). The Chinese yuan stands at Rs 22.01 and Rs 22.10, the Saudi riyal at Rs 40.13 and Rs 40.29, and the Qatari riyal at Rs 41.28 and Rs 41.45.

Similarly, the Thai baht is set at Rs 4.65 (buying) and Rs 4.67 (selling), the UAE dirham at Rs 40.97 and Rs 41.14, and the Malaysian ringgit at Rs 37.96 and Rs 38.11. One hundred South Korean won are valued at Rs 10.18 and Rs 10.22, while the Swedish krona stands at Rs 16.31 and Rs 16.38, and the Danish krone at Rs 23.60 and Rs 23.69.

Among other currencies, the Hong Kong dollar is fixed at Rs 19.21 (buying) and Rs 19.29 (selling), the Kuwaiti dinar at Rs 490.87 and Rs 492.82, the Bahraini dinar at Rs 398.57 and Rs 400.16, and the Omani rial at Rs 390.90 and Rs 392.46. The exchange rate for 100 Indian rupees has been set at Rs 160 (buying) and Rs 160.15 (selling).

The central bank noted that these rates are subject to revision at any time as needed. Exchange rates offered by commercial banks may vary, and updated rates are available on the bank’s official website.
